生产环境常见的HTTP状态码列表

  

200 -好,服务器成功返回网页

  
      <李>标准HTTP请求响应成功。   
  

301 -永久移动(永久跳转),请求的网页已永久跳转到新位置。

  
      <李>这和未来所有的请求应该指向给定。
    304(未修改)自从上次请求后,请求的网页未修改过。服务器返回此响应时,不会返回网页内容。   
  

如果网页自请求者上次请求后再也没有更改过,您应将服务器配置为返回此响应(称为if - modified - since HTTP标头)。服务器可以告诉谷歌蜘蛛自从上次抓取后网页没有变更,进而节省带宽和开销。

  

403 -禁止(禁止访问),服务器拒绝请求,此类问题一般是服务器或服务权限配置不当所致。
原因之一:是nginx配置文件里没有配置默认首页参数,或首页文件在站点目录下没有如下内容:
指数指数。php指数。html你;
原因之二:站点目录下没有配置文件里指定的首页文件。
原因之三:站点目录或内容的程序文件没有nginx用户访问权限。
原因之四:nginx配置文件中设置了允许否认等权限控制,导致客户端没有访问权限。

  
      <李>禁止请求(匹配否认过滤器)=比;李HTTP 403   <李>请求法律请求,但服务器拒绝回应。   
  

404 -没有发现,404 -请求的网页不存在

  

服务器找不到请求的页面。可能客户端服务器上不存在资源所致。

  
      <李>所请求的资源不能被发现,但在未来可能再次可用。   
  

500内部服务器错误(内部服务器错误),例如selinux开启,有没为其设置许可。

  
      <李> haproxy=比内部错误;李HTTP 500   <李>一个通用的错误消息,因为在没有更具体的信息是合适的。   
  

502 -错误网关(坏的网关),一般是网关服务器请求后端服务时,后端服务没有按照http协议正确返回结果。

  
      <李>服务器返回一个无效的或不完整的响应=比;李HTTP 502   <李>服务器作为网关或代理,从上游服务器收到无效响应。   
  

503 -服务不可用(服务当前不可用),可能因为超载或停机维护.503——服务器超时

  
 <代码>——没有服务器可用来处理请求=比;HTTP 503
  服务器目前不可用(因为它是重载或维护)。 
  

504 -网关超时(网关超时),一般是网关服务器请求后端服务时,后端服务没有在特定的时间内完成服务。

  
      <李>服务器未能及时回复=比;李HTTP 504   <李>服务器作为网关或代理,没有得到及时的响应从上游服务器。   

生产环境常见的HTTP状态码列表